    Netflix’s The Circle: Latest Updates For Season 6

    The Circle is a hit reality show for the Netflix streaming service alongside its other reality shows LOVE Is Blind, and Too Hot To Handle. Fans of The Circle are dying for when Season 6 will air as the show was renewed for Seasons 6 and 7. REALITY TEA describes, “The Circle is based on a previous UK series of the same name. Like Love Is Blind and The Ultimatum, this reality show serves as one of Netflix’s social experiments. Contestants are forbidden from communicating face to face, instead using a system resembling social media apps. Is it any wonder the show became such a hit during the pandemic lockdown? There’s plenty of flirting and bonding, but contestants are more susceptible to catfishing, which leads to some twisty drama. In the end, the top influencer earns a six-figure cash prize.”

    Each season there are twists. For example, one twist on season 2, one of The Spice Girls was on the show. The last season was known as the “singles” season. All the players were single.

    That was not the only twist. In the last 2 seasons, the first 2 players blocked are brought back and forced to work together as a catfish praying they do not get blocked again. Big Brother’s 20, Brett Robinson, appeared on Season 5 and he was one of the first 2 blocked along with Xanthi.

    Season 6 should be available on April 17, 2024. The show has been filmed in Salford, a small town in Northern England for the last 5 seasons but for future seasons, it will be filmed in Atlanta, Georgia.

    Season 6 has promised new twists. One of those twists is letting an AI bot play as a catfish. According to TUDUM by Netflix, “Oh, but there is one game-changing twist we should probably mention: For the first time ever, an AI bot is entering the game as the ultimate catfish. Will the metal menace outsmart us all? Or will the human players use their intelligence to suss out anything artificial?” TUDUM also revealed, “Max has studied past seasons and used previous competitors as inspiration to create the perfect profile. Basically, Max is [a] social media catnip for the rest of the players, who initially have no idea that an AI bot is among them.”

    We also have the names of our new Circle players. Let’s get to know them now.

    1. Kyle is 31 from Miami, Florida.

    TUDUM states, “Proud dog dad’ Kyle just couldn’t join The Circle solo, so he’s entering the game with his best (furry) friend, Deuce. The married professional basketball player is competitive at heart, saying, “I hate losing more than I like winning.” But to get players off his scent, he’s joining the experiment as an extremely single basketball trainer.”

    2. Cassie is 29 and from Manchester, Kentucky.

    TUDUM states, “This Southern belle has a history with catfishing, as she caught her ex-husband cheating after making a fake profile. “A fake can point out another fake,” she says. But Cassie is putting the past behind her by joining the game as herself: a newly engaged mother of two who’s ready to expose the competition.”

    3) Brandon is 34 from Columbus, Ohio.

    TUDUM expresses, “As a self-described ‘adult Cabbage Patch kid,’ Brandon is ditching his real-life persona and going full catfish in the game. The nursing assistant will be playing as his friend and colleague Olivia, hoping to combine his “brains and personality’ with her ‘body-ody-ody” to come out on top. ‘This is my opportunity to be hot because I’ve never gotten to do that before, he says.”

    4).Quori-Tyler is 26 and from Los Angeles, California.

    TUDUM pitches, “This former NBA dancer is no stranger to making moves — and she won’t be dancing around anyone’s feelings in the chat. Quori-Tyler is coming into The Circle as a secret superfan, who’s watched every single episode multiple times. ‘I’m here to play the game and be a mastermind at it,’ she says. And while she’s all about strategy, a Circle romance isn’t completely off the table for Quori-Tyler, as she says she’s ‘single as a Pringle.’”

    5). Lauren is 26 and from Philadelphia, Pennsylvania.

    TUDUM reports, “Lauren is ready to ‘slay the day’ by being 100% herself in The Circle. The former Twitch streamer is comfortable talking to people through a screen — after all, she used to game for up to 10 hours a day. Lauren is open to all kinds of connections in the experiment, as she’s a ‘naturally flirty’ nerd who’s fresh out of a relationship.”

    6) Carress is 26 and from Dallas, Texas.

    TUDUM presents. “A motivational speaker, Caress has a natural way with words. But she’s trading in speeches for bars, joining the game as her younger brother Paul, a rapper and singer. ‘Everybody’s catfishing online, so why not me?’ she says. Caress hopes that she’ll be able to harness her sibling’s social media power — he has more than 300,000 followers while going into the game, she’s barely cracked 3,000.”

    7). Myles is 29 and from Los Angeles, California

    Tudum pitches,”Don’t judge Myles (or his alter ego, (‘Yung Papi Fuego’) by appearances. While he openly embraces his self-described ‘f**kboy energy, he’s also an AI engineer who has a knack for strategizing and calling out catfishes. ‘I’m either you love or hate me type of guy,’ he says. As a ‘huge flirt,’ Myles is hoping the ladies in the game skew toward the former.”

    8). Steffi is 35 and from Redondo Beach, California.

    TUDUM asservates, “Charge your crystals and unblock your chakras because Steffi is here to make her mark (along with her emotional support skeleton). The psychic medium and professional astrologer will be using her fine-tuned intuition in the game to outlast the other players. But she isn’t telling anyone about her (super)natural gifts — or that her dead aunt might be giving her tips in the game.”

    9) Autumn is 21 and from Murfreesboro, Tennessee.

    TUDUM declares, “Players be warned: Autumn is used to getting her hands dirty, working outdoors, and wrangling animals as a full-time ranch hand. She’s bringing an ‘I don’t give a damn’ attitude into the game, where she’s competing as her ‘genuine weird redneck self.’ To land herself in the finale, Autumn is planning on building alliances, leveraging her Southern charm, and flexing her flirting skills if need be.”

    10). Jordan is 24 and hails from Austin, Texas.

    TUDUM affirms, “Jordan is heading into The Circle as himself — but with a little bit of a twist. Since he now gets ‘easily mistaken as a douchebag’ online, the photographer is turning back the clock a few years to appear more approachable. ‘Before I lost weight, everyone saw me as a friendly giant,’ he says. But don’t let his ‘Big J’ persona fool you, as Jordan is ready to get messy in the game and spread misinformation to make it to the top.”
